|
@@ -5,6 +5,7 @@ import org.springframework.context.annotation.Configuration;
|
|
|
import org.springframework.http.HttpHeaders;
|
|
|
import springfox.documentation.builders.ApiInfoBuilder;
|
|
|
import springfox.documentation.builders.ParameterBuilder;
|
|
|
+import springfox.documentation.builders.PathSelectors;
|
|
|
import springfox.documentation.builders.RequestHandlerSelectors;
|
|
|
import springfox.documentation.schema.ModelRef;
|
|
|
import springfox.documentation.service.ApiInfo;
|
|
@@ -16,8 +17,6 @@ import springfox.documentation.swagger2.annotations.EnableSwagger2;
|
|
|
import java.util.ArrayList;
|
|
|
import java.util.List;
|
|
|
|
|
|
-import static springfox.documentation.builders.PathSelectors.regex;
|
|
|
-
|
|
|
@Configuration
|
|
|
@EnableSwagger2
|
|
|
public class SwaggerConfig {
|
|
@@ -41,8 +40,8 @@ public class SwaggerConfig {
|
|
|
.select()
|
|
|
.apis(RequestHandlerSelectors.basePackage("com.its.vms.api.controller"))
|
|
|
//.paths(PathSelectors.any())
|
|
|
- //.paths(PathSelectors.ant("/api/vms/control/**"))
|
|
|
- .paths(regex("/api/vms/(control|esb)/.*"))
|
|
|
+ .paths(PathSelectors.ant("/api/vms/control/**"))
|
|
|
+ //.paths(regex("/api/vms/(control|esb)/.*"))
|
|
|
.build();
|
|
|
}
|
|
|
|